#7b1956 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#7b1956 is composed of 48.2% red, 9.8% green and 33.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 79.7% magenta, 30.1% yellow and 51.8% black. It has a hue angle of 322.7 degrees, a saturation of 66.2% and a lightness of 29%. #7b1956 color hex could be obtained by blending #f632ac with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

#7b1956 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#7b1956 has RGB values of R:123, G:25, B:86 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.8, Y:0.3, K:0.52. Its decimal value is 8067414.

Shades and Tints of #7b1956
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090206 is the darkest color, while #fdf8f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#7b1956
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4d474b is the less saturated color, while #92025c is the most saturated one.
